Hello too all
i really need some help from you guys
ive owned 2 cbr400 nc29 over last 10years, my problem ive had is the the fairings keep cracking due the vibration stress on the fixing points (lugs/tabs) cracking them. i could just put a rubber washer on, or maybe a rubber inlet washer (tophat washer) so the screw doesnt touch the fairing atall when attached....will this do? what do you guys use?
does anybody have any ideas, know where i can purchase the original rubber washers or a decent substitute?
ive bought a whole new fairing kit from skidmarx and dont wana put them on without the right washers

You want some rubber gromments http://www.grommets.co.uk/index.php/products and the metal insert is called a bush - you can get them from ProBolt. Measure the hol diameter, the recess dia and the panel thickness.
If you want to repair the originals use some Plastex
